In an article two years ago in the New England Journal of Medicine, Dr. Ezekiel Emanuel and his colleague Dr. Victor Fuchs, emeritus professor of economics at Stanford University, coined the phrase “HealthCare Vouchers” as a national reform plan for our broken health care system. Since then, they’ve presented their paper to the Brookings Institute and gained national attention for the proposal’s ten fundamental principles, outlined here:
  • Guaranteed health care for all Americans
  • Comprehensive benefits
  • Free choice of plan and providers
  • Freedom to purchase additional services
  • Funding by an earmarked value-added tax
  • End of employer-based health insurance
  • Phasing out of Medicare and Medicaid
  • Independent oversight
  • Cost and quality control
  • Patient safety and dispute resolution
